{Navigating the Test: Common Mistakes and How to Avoiding Them
Many aspiring drivers stumble during their driving test, often due to correctable errors. One frequent issue is failing to to check mirrors sufficiently. Remember to glance in your mirrors approximately every seconds, especially before changing direction. Another pitfall is hesitant speed control; maintain a safe speed and avoid abrupt acceleration or braking. Poor observation is also a significant factor – consistently scan your surroundings for passersby, cyclists, and other vehicles. Lastly, show good judgment at rotaries and when coming to junctions – anticipate other drivers’ actions and be prepared to stop. Careful practice and focusing on these areas will greatly increase your chances of succeeding in your driving test.

Familiarizing yourself with Driving Test Routes: The Expectation
Preparing for your driving test can feel nerve-wracking, and a big part of that is understanding the possible routes you might encounter. While examiners won't tell you the specific path you’re going to take, they do operate within a pre-set network of roads. These routes are usually chosen to assess a range of skills, including controlling the vehicle in different situations – urban areas, congested roads, and sometimes even less populated environments. You can often find information about common routes in your region through online forums or by asking experienced drivers. Don't rely solely on this though; the key is to practice in a variety of locations and master the basics of safe driving, so you’re prepared to handle unforeseen scenarios, regardless of the route you’ll be taking.
